On Sunday night's episode, the celebrities were challenged to bake and sell pies in New York City. A special prize was awarded to the team with the best pie, according to Cake Boss' Buddy Valestro. Unfortunately for Gosselin though, she failed to raise one dollar despite making a best-selling cookbook author and being an avid baker at home with her eight children.
